Pepsin from porcine gastric mucosa, CAS # 9001-75-6, is a peptidase that is commonly used in enzymatic digestion of proteins. | CAS: 9001-75-6

General Description

  • Pepsin is an endopeptidase that digests proteins by hydrolyzing peptide bonds
  • It is the active form of pepsinogen, which is produced in the chief cells of the gastric mucosa

Applications

  • Pepsin is commonly used to produce F(ab’)2 fragments from antibodies
  • It has been used along with other enzymes to demonstrate the effects of fixation and enzymatic digestion in immunohistochemical assays, using paraffin-embedded tissue
  • It can be used in hydrolyzing dry cervical samples in mice
  • It has been used in the digestion of crude wheat gliadin
  • It has been used to stimulate in vitro gastric digestion of cooked cod, cocoa mass, and dietary fiber
